Key Ingredients & Substitutions

Watermelon: Choose ripe, seedless watermelon for the best flavor. If watermelon is not available, cantaloupe can be a nice alternative, though it will change the taste slightly.

Lemon Juice: Freshly squeezed lemon juice is best for a bright flavor. If you don’t have fresh lemons, you can use bottled lemon juice, but I always prefer fresh for that zing!

Sugar: Granulated sugar gives sweetness, but feel free to substitute with honey, agave, or a sugar alternative like stevia for a healthier option. Just remember that sweetness levels may vary.

Mint Leaves: Fresh mint is key for that refreshing taste. Dried mint can work in a pinch, but fresh makes a big difference. You could also try basil for a twist!

How Do You Make the Watermelon Puree Smooth?

The first step is blending the watermelon cubes until smooth. Here’s how to get that perfect puree:

  • Cut your watermelon into small cubes to help it blend easily.
  • Blend in batches if your blender is small to avoid overfilling.
  • Once blended, strain through a fine mesh sieve to remove any pulp; this keeps your drink smooth and refreshing.

This technique creates a lovely texture that makes your lemonade feel light and enjoyable!

Copycat Chick-fil-A Watermelon Mint Lemonade

Ingredients You’ll Need:

For the Lemonade:

  • 4 cups seedless watermelon, cubed
  • 1 cup freshly squeezed lemon juice (about 6 lemons)
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ar (adjust to taste)
  • 4 cups cold water
  • 10-12 fresh mint leaves, plus extra for garnish
  • Ice cubes

For Garnish:

  • Watermelon slices
  • Lemon wedges

How Much Time Will You Need?

This refreshing watermelon mint lemonade takes about 15 minutes to prepare and at least 1 hour to chill, allowing the flavors to meld beautifully. So, plan for a total of around 1 hour and 15 minutes before you can sip and enjoy. Perfect for a warm day!

Step-by-Step Instructions:

1. Blend the Watermelon:

Start by placing the watermelon cubes into a blender. Blend on high speed until the mixture is nice and smooth. This should only take a minute or so. You want a good watermelon puree for your lemonade!

2. Strain the Puree:

Using a fine mesh sieve, strain the watermelon puree into a large pitcher to remove any pulp. This step gives your lemonade a silky texture, making it super refreshing and easy to drink.

3. Mix in the Lemon Juice and Sugar:

Next, add the freshly squeezed lemon juice and the granulated sugar to the pitcher. Pour in the cold water as well. Stir everything together well until the sugar dissolves completely. You can taste it at this point and adjust the sweetness if you’d like!

4. Add Fresh Mint:

Tear the mint leaves gently with your fingers to release their refreshing aroma. Add them to the pitcher and give it a gentle stir. This helps the mint infuse beautifully into the lemonade.

5. Chill the Lemonade:

Cover the pitcher and pop it in the refrigerator for at least 1 hour. This lets all the flavors mingle together, making the drink even more delicious!

6. Serve and Enjoy:

When you’re ready to serve, fill glasses with ice cubes. Pour the chilled watermelon mint lemonade over the ice, and garnish each glass with a slice of watermelon, a lemon wedge, and a fresh mint sprig. It’s a pretty drink, too!

7. Final Touch:

Give it a little stir before you take a sip. Now, sit back, relax, and enjoy this delightful beverage! Perfect for parties, picnics, or just a sunny day at home.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Can I Use Store-Bought Watermelon Juice Instead of Fresh Watermelon?

Yes, you can use store-bought watermelon juice for convenience! Just make sure it’s 100% juice with no added sugars. You can skip the blending and straining steps, but fresh watermelon will give you the best flavor and freshness!

How Do I Adjust the Sweetness of the Lemonade?

If you find the lemonade too sweet or not sweet enough, feel free to adjust the sugar. Start with the suggested 1/2 cup, then taste it. You can add more sugar if needed or dilute it with extra cold water or lemon juice for balance!

Can I Make This Lemonade Ahead of Time?

Absolutely! You can prepare this watermelon mint lemonade a day in advance. Just store it in the refrigerator. It’s best enjoyed within 2-3 days for maximum freshness, but make sure to give it a good stir before serving, as some separation might occur.

What’s the Best Way to Store Leftover Lemonade?

Store any leftover lemonade in an airtight container in the refrigerator. It will stay fresh for up to 3 days. If you want to keep it longer, consider freezing it in ice cube trays and use the cubes to chill your future drinks!
